Here's the March drawing assortment. I chose an ultralite package since the season openers will most likely be hitting the streams. One exception, since the snows falling out here in Colorado today, I included an Ice Rocker jig (the pink tri-color zonker with the 3D eyes on metal body).

I don't know about you, but I have some slow moving, deeply undercut stream bank hiding places that I could see giving the jig some time in the water around.

This is currently all our small spinner models; 1/12oz glass Armadillo with the copper french blade, 2 1/10oz Small Metal Armdillos with the 8mm Orange faceted tails, 1/10oz Fire Ant with the red props, 1/10oz Nitromite with the Silver Indiana - Gold body and black faceted glass, 1/10oz Hot Rod double bladed - Salt White with Red tail. The rocker jig weighs 1/5oz and has two nickel propellers for a little motion and noise.
